New gated vehicular site entrance, modifications to existing security fencing…
Boyne Enterprise Road , Greenhills Drogheda , Co.Louth
Proposed development
Permission for a new gated vehicular site entrance, modifications to existing security fencing and footpath and all associated site development works
What happens next
Permission was granted on 29 Feb 2024. Third parties may appeal within four weeks; after that the permission is final and works can start once a commencement notice is lodged.
